/* Standards-compliant CSS hover menus

*/
#menu, #menu ul {
	/* all menus */
	font-family:  verdana, arial,helvetica, sans-serif;
	font-size: 14px;
	list-style: none;
	padding: 0px 0px 3px 0px;
	margin: 0;
	width: 90%;
	
}
#menu li {
	/* all list items */
	float: left;
	position: relative;
	width: 100px;
	vertical-align: middle;
}
#menu a {
	/* all menu links */
	background-color: #4a7b41;
	
	color: #ffffff;
	display: block;
	font-weight: 100;
	padding: 3px 0px 4px 3px;
	text-align: left;
	
	text-decoration: none;
}
#menu a:hover {
	color: #5d2567;	
	background-color: #d0e2af;
	border-right: 2px solid #ffffff;
	border-left: 2px solid #ffffff;
	border-top: 2px solid #ffffff;
	border-bottom: 2px solid #ffffff;
}
#menu ul li a {
	/* sub menu items */
	background-color: #D0E2AF;
	
	
	color: #5d2567;	
	font-weight: normal;
	font-size: 12px;
	text-align: left;
	text-transform: none;
	padding: 3px 3px 3px 3px;
	width: 90px;
	
}
#menu ul li a:hover {
	/* sub menu items hover */
	
	background: #D0E2AF;
		
}
#menu li ul {
	/* all sub menus */
	background: #ffffff;
	
	left: -999em;
	position: absolute;
	width: 100px;
}
#menu li:hover ul, #menu li.over ul {
	/* hover magic */
	left: 2px;
}
/* Fix IE. Hide from IE Mac \*/
* html #menu { float: left; }
* html #menu a { height: 1%; }
/* End Fix IE */
p {
	font-family: "Century Gothic", "Avant Garde", Arial, sans-serif;
	color: #666666;
}
